We summarize the results from SMOV on the baseline performance of the STIS CCD. Read-out noise, dark current, charge transfer efficiency, and gain are measured. All CCD parameters turn out to be consistent with those measured during Ground Calibration.For in-flight unbinned data taken in CCDGAIN=1, the read-out noise is 3.78 ± 0.05 electrons, the dark current is 0.0015 ± 0.0003 electrons per second, and the gain is 0.97 ± 0.02 electrons per ADU.
